The Local Access Forum advises the Authority, and other organisations, at a strategic level on how to make Dartmoor more accessible and … WebAug 31, 2016 · One of the responsibilities of the Dartmoor Commoners Council is the ponies who graze on the moor. In recent years, their population has continued to decline and the council was concerned about the ecological impact on the moor. They commissioned a study relevant to pony grazing on upland habitats.
